The history of constitution development states that the key point constitutionalconstruction doesn't lie in the constitution itself ,but in it's practice. If the society cannot provide the constitution with elementary conditions, it will not be put intoenforcement. So, we are facing an essential problem on how to construct theconsitution. The author of the thesis thinks that we should begin with theconstitutional construction and relate it with the procedure.In this way,we can renewthe system and maitain the order of our society.The thesis contains three parts. The author of the thesis starting with the basicprinciple /theory of constitutional procedure , comparison of different constitutionalprocedure, discusses how to perfect the constitutional procedure.In part one, the author of the thesis makes an introduction to the basic theory ofconstitutional procedure.First, define the constitutional procedure. It refers to the rights and obligationswhich come into being during the subject creates and implements the constitutionaccording to the legal procedure, steps and means. There are three procedures:legislation, implement and protection. It has three attributes: practicability, stabilityand autonomy.Secondly , classify the values of the constitutional procedure, it can be classifiedinto utilitarian value and motive value. The former embodies the following:1,constitutional procedure can assure the subject makes proper decision.2,constitutional procedure can contribute to realize constitutional democracy.3,constitutional procedure can make constitution crate,amend and implement by itselfaccordings to it's operating rule.The latter refers to the character of goodness whichlies in the constitutional procedure, i.e. freedom, justice, reasonableness and effect.They are related to each other and make up for each other. Justice is the core whilefreedom , reasonableness and effct are necessary factors. No matter which is lost, theprocedure will be unfair. We make judgement according to wether it is fair more thanwether it helps to make substantial justice come true. It gives us the answer to theproblem why the constitutional procedure is reasonable and it also founds the basisfor the independence of the constitutional procedure. 45Thirdly, analyse the basic principle of the constitutional procedure whichinvolves five: neutrality, participating in , publicity, reasonableness and autonomy.Neutrality is a basic requirement to the person who controls the procedure.Participating in the pocedure is a basic human right of the clients. Publicity is thebasic requirement to the process. Reasonableness is the basic source of the dueprocess. Autonomy requires procedure is isolated from the outside world.In part two , the author of the thesis makes a research on different constitutionalprocedure by comparison.Nowdays, many countries have built up constitutional procedure suitable forthemselves according to their own peculiar legal tradition , political system and legalculture. America represents the due legal procedure mode which is popular with thecommon law system countries. Germany stands for the strict rule mode which isapplicable in the civil law system countries.First, compare the two constitutional procedure modes. There are suchdifferences between them as the constitutions themselves aims at value , culturebackgrounds and basis of knowledge.Secondly, give an appraisement on the two modes. The advantages of the strictrule mode: in the country where the legal culture isn't developed and the judges'quality is low, the mode contributes to uniform the legal system, prevent the judicialcorruption causing by judges' misusing their power, prohibit the judges and courtsfrom becoming the violent tools of the authority. The disadvantages are that it's costly,and low efficient.
